  1. 1 Whether statements by a company agent at the Labour Department are hearsay or admissible as party admissions
  2. 2 Whether the employer lawfully deducted seven days annual leave such that constructive dismissal arose
  3. 3 Whether the presiding officer erred in calculation of the monetary award and set-off

Ratio Decidendi

Although the presiding officer was wrong to characterise the agent's statements as hearsay, that error did not undermine the factual findings; the presiding officer's conclusion that there was no constructive dismissal because the annual leave deduction was lawful and leave had been given was upheld; the monetary award was corrected by set-off and reduced to $1,011.40; no costs were ordered.

Court Disposition

Appeal allowed in part; primary factual findings and conclusion of no constructive dismissal upheld; award reduced

Orders

  • Appeal allowed to the extent of reducing the award from $2,177.40 to $1,011.40
  • Respondent awarded $1,011.40
